原文:mingw打dll ,lib包命令和調用

,下面的命令行將這個代碼編譯成dll。 gcc mydll.c shared o mydll.dll Wl, out implib,mydll.lib 其中 shared告訴gccdlltest.c文件需要編譯成動態鏈接庫。 Wl表示后面的內容是ld的參數,需要傳遞給ld。 out implib,dlltest.lib表示讓ld生成一個名為dlltest.lib的導入庫。 如果還需要.def文件 ...

2017-11-02 17:44 0 2877 推薦指數:

查看詳情

MSVC和MinGW組件dll相互調用

http://www.mingw.org/wiki/msvc_and_mingw_dlls MinGW調用VC: The other way is to produce the .a files for GCC. For __cdecl functions (in most cases ...

Mon Jul 04 02:30:00 CST 2016 0 1667
C++ 調用libdll的 方法 及 動態庫DLL與靜態庫lib的區別

C++ 調用.lib的方法: 一: 隱式的加載時鏈接,有三種方法 1 LIB文件直接加入到工程文件列表中   在VC中打開File View一頁,選中工程名,單擊鼠標右鍵,然后選中"Add Files to Project"菜單,在彈出的文件對話框中選中要加入DLLLIB文件 ...

Tue Nov 06 23:34:00 CST 2012 0 33274
QT調用第三方dll (Lib方式)

在項目的.pro文件中,增加一句 在.cpp文件中,聲明mydll.dll里面導出的函數: 然后就可以調用了: ...

Wed Jun 12 21:14:00 CST 2019 0 1162
VC2008調用matlab生成的dlllib

在Matlab中,編寫一個M文件(myadd.m),保存 上述函數實現單獨的數或者是數組相加和相乘。 設置matlab編譯器 過程如下: 1. 在matlab的command window里面敲入mex –setup,(此命令不允許-和setup有空格)matlab會列出所有 ...

Thu Aug 30 06:24:00 CST 2012 1 3409
SubSonic3.0.0.4.3源碼調用Dll

版本修改歷史 3.0.0.4.3版修復了下面問題: 修正多表關聯查詢時,使用左關聯和右關聯出錯問題修正DbDataProvider.cs類的ToEnumerable函數打開數據庫鏈接后沒有關閉的問 ...

Sun Mar 23 00:05:00 CST 2014 6 1924
SubSonic3.0.0.4.1源碼調用Dll

================================================================ 名 稱:SubSonic插件版 本:3.0.0.4.1最 ...

Sun Aug 11 01:56:00 CST 2013 7 1147
MinGW(GCC)編譯DLL文件

這兩天用CB(Code::Blocks)寫個小程序,要編譯出DLL供VB(6)使用。CB使用mingw-gcc作為編譯器,在庫文件的產出上跟VC、VS之類的IDE略有不同。 由於C語言的基礎知識不是太好,尤其對編譯環節更是知之甚少。結果,試了幾次,導出的DLL中的函數總是無法被調用。 用VB ...

Thu Nov 27 22:29:00 CST 2014 0 9254
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M